The Road to the River

Author: Helen ArmstrongIllustrator: Steve Dell

This is the sequel to Armstrong’s much praised debut novel, The Road to Somewhere and it brings back the main characters – Cow, Woolly Woolly Baa Lamb and of course Ratty. You are plunged into the adventure in the first pages: Bad Things have terrified the hens on the farm where the animals live and are out to get all pets. Then comes a message from the animals’ old friend Minka: she is a prisoner of the Bad Things and desperately needs help. Ratty’s first-person narrative with its short, staccato sentences creates an irresistible pace as well as a real sense of his character. The story is told in the present tense throughout and this too gives it an immediacy and distinctiveness.

The pace is maintained right to the final chapter when it is happy endings all round – even for the villain. These haven’t come easily though; there is no sentimentality in the book, just respect for the animal characters and for their wild nature. An author to watch.
